Output 366b0c4889f96ea789c1b65c53fd8f171ebd771d8af2d646af353b099c271eda:26

value
42148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8c3ebbf3472c68f095c033df71e778afd5c296 OP_EQUAL
address
3Qd5Y6CbBWYTUjWquh25T5VMGf9ugb8eDe
transaction
366b0c4889f96ea789c1b65c53fd8f171ebd771d8af2d646af353b099c271eda
spent
true